加入收藏 | 设为首页 | 会员中心 | 我要投稿 站长网 (https://www.jiakaowang.com/)- 应用程序、AI行业应用、CDN、低代码、区块链!
当前位置: 首页 > 服务器 > 搭建环境 > Unix > 正文

Unix包管理:极速搭建信息流处理环境

发布时间:2026-06-16 15:20:55 所属栏目:Unix 来源:DaWei
导读:  在快速搭建信息流处理环境时,Unix系统凭借其强大的命令行工具和成熟的包管理机制,成为开发者的首选。通过简单的命令,即可完成从基础依赖到复杂框架的部署,极大提升效率。  以apt(Debian/Ubuntu)或yum/dn

  在快速搭建信息流处理环境时,Unix系统凭借其强大的命令行工具和成熟的包管理机制,成为开发者的首选。通过简单的命令,即可完成从基础依赖到复杂框架的部署,极大提升效率。


  以apt(Debian/Ubuntu)或yum/dnf(CentOS/RHEL)为例,只需一条命令便可安装核心组件。例如,运行 sudo apt update && sudo apt install -y python3-pip git,即可同步软件源并安装Python包管理器与版本控制工具,为后续开发奠定基础。


  接下来,借助pip可快速集成主流信息流处理库。如安装Apache Kafka客户端:pip install kafka-python,或引入Apache Flink的Python绑定:pip install apache-flink。这些操作均在几秒内完成,无需手动编译或配置复杂依赖。


  若需更高级的环境隔离,可使用虚拟环境。执行python3 -m venv env,再激活 source env/bin/activate,确保项目依赖互不干扰。随后,通过requirements.txt文件统一管理依赖,实现一键复现环境。


  对于分布式处理场景,可通过包管理器安装Docker。在Ubuntu上运行 sudo apt install docker.io,然后添加当前用户至docker组,即可直接运行Kafka、Redis等服务镜像。例如,docker run -d -p 9092:9092 --name kafka confluentinc/cp-kafka,快速启动一个消息队列实例。


  整个过程仅需十余条命令,从系统准备到服务上线,全程自动化。这不仅节省时间,也降低了人为错误风险。相比传统手动配置,效率提升数倍。


2026AI模拟图,仅供参考

  Unix的包管理不仅是工具,更是一种高效协作的实践。它让开发者专注于业务逻辑,而非环境搭建。在信息流处理这种高迭代、高并发的场景中,极速部署能力正是核心竞争力之一。

(编辑:站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章